Abstract: |
Monitoring topsoil-stripping in advance of the construction of two new houses to the E of Rustic Lodge, between the Comrie Bridge to Kenmore Road and the River Tay. Topsoil and other modern materials were stripped by machine to reveal fluvio-glacial deposits of gravel, pebbles and boulders with occasional lenses of coarse sand. Nothing of archaeological significance was uncovered. |
